Description

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of chemical fiber equipment technology, and in particular to a total reflection side-blowing device. Background Technology

[0002] In the production of synthetic fibers, filaments require air cooling, and there are two cooling methods: side blowing and ring blowing. Side blowing has the advantage of a larger air volume and better cooling effect, making it suitable for producing coarse denier filaments; while ring blowing, with its circular airflow, provides uniform cooling, resulting in better filament evenness, making it suitable for producing fine denier, porous filaments. In actual production, because early production lines were mostly equipped with side blowing (ring blowing technology was developed later), using side blowing lines to produce fine denier filaments can lead to uneven airflow, resulting in poor filament evenness and uneven dyeing. Utility Model Content

[0003] The purpose of this invention is to provide a total reflection side-blowing device. By attaching rubber sheets, the cooling air can be reflected, making the cooling air more uniform, which can significantly improve the quality of chemical fiber products and reduce the cost of production line modification.

[0004] The above-mentioned technical objective of this utility model is achieved through the following technical solution:

[0005] A total reflection side-blowing device includes two laminar flow elements arranged opposite each other, and each laminar flow element includes multiple grid plates evenly distributed in the vertical direction;

[0006] The outer laminar flow unit is covered with rubber. Cooling air is ejected from the inside of the inner laminar flow unit from the inside out. The air is rectified by multiple grids in the laminar flow unit. After passing through the yarn, the cooling air enters the outer laminar flow unit. Then, the rubber blocks and reflects the cooling air. The reflected cooling air is then blown back onto the yarn from other directions, thus achieving a similar effect to ring blowing. This improves the uniformity of yarn cooling and significantly enhances yarn quality, as evidenced by a significant decrease in the yarn evenness CV value, from 1.6 to 0.7.

[0007] The present invention is further configured such that the rubber sheet is detachably connected to the outer laminar flow device via adhesive tape, thereby facilitating the installation and removal of the rubber sheet. When side blowing is required, the rubber sheet can be removed; when a ring blowing effect is required, the rubber sheet is fixed to the outer laminar flow device with adhesive tape.

[0008] The present invention is further configured such that: the outer side of the outer laminar flower is formed with a wavy curved surface;

[0009] The rubber sheet is wavy and adheres to the wavy curved surface.

[0010] The rubber sheet is designed in a wavy shape, which allows for multi-directional reflection, resulting in better reflection and more even cooling airflow.

[0011] The present invention is further configured such that the rubber sheet is fixed on the corrugated retaining plate, and the retaining plate facilitates the shaping of the rubber sheet, thereby facilitating the installation of the rubber sheet onto the corrugated curved surface of the laminar flow device.

[0012] The present invention is further configured such that: multiple screws are fixed on the corrugated retaining plate, and top sleeves are screwed onto the screws. The top sleeves abut against the corresponding side plates of the chemical fiber equipment and are supported by the multiple top sleeves on the side plates. The top sleeves support the corrugated retaining plate through the screws. Rotating the top sleeves allows them to move on the screws, thereby allowing for spacing adjustment to meet different spacing requirements.

[0013] The present invention is further configured such that: a rubber head is provided on the outer side of the top sleeve, which can increase the frictional resistance between the top sleeve and the corresponding side plate of the chemical fiber equipment, and prevent it from slipping or loosening.
